Responsibility
- Supervise and lead the hotmeal section, ensuring efficient preparation, cooking, and plating of dishes in accordance with Erajaya’s standards.
- Monitor food quality, portion control, and presentation to maintain consistency across all outlets.
- Train, mentor, and evaluate junior kitchen staff, fostering a culture of excellence and teamwork.
- Collaborate with the Head Chef and other supervisors to develop and refine menus, incorporating seasonal ingredients and culinary trends.
- Ensure compliance with food safety, hygiene, and sanitation regulations at all times.
- Manage inventory, minimize waste, and optimize kitchen resources to support cost-effective operations.
- Assist in planning and executing special events, promotions, and catering services as required.
- Stay updated on industry trends, new cooking techniques, and emerging ingredients to enhance culinary offerings.
Qualifications
- Minimum 3-5 years of experience as a Chef de Partie (CDP) or similar role in a high-volume hot kitchen, preferably in hospitality or F&B.
- Strong expertise in Asian and Western cuisines, with proficiency in grilling, sautéing, frying, and other hotmeal techniques.
- Proven leadership skills with the ability to train, motivate, and manage a team in a fast-paced environment.
- In-depth knowledge of food safety, HACCP, and sanitation standards.
- Culinary diploma or equivalent certification from a recognized institution is a plus.
- Excellent time management and multitasking abilities to handle peak service hours.
- Strong communication skills in English; proficiency in Bahasa Indonesia is advantageous.
- Flexibility to work in rotating shifts, including evenings, weekends, and holidays.
